Step-by-step troubleshooting
Check your internet connection and browser
A weak connection or outdated browser can cause form submission failures. Try these quick fixes:
- Reload the page and try again.
- Switch to a modern browser (Chrome, Edge, Firefox, Safari).
- Clear cookies and cache, or use a private/incognito window.
- Disable ad-blockers or privacy extensions that may block scripts.
Verify your email and spam folder
If you didn’t receive a verification email:
- Check spam, promotions, and junk folders.
- Search for emails from no-reply@slotlair or similar addresses.
- Use the “resend verification” option if available.
Re-check the personal details you entered
Small typos can cause rejections. Ensure:
- Your full name matches official ID format.
- Birthdate confirms you’re over 18 (21 in some regions) and matches ID.
- Your email and phone number are entered correctly without spaces.
- Your postal address and country align with UK formats if you’re registering from the UK.
Address geo-location and VPN issues
Slot Lair performs geo-location checks. If your IP looks outside the UK or masked:
- Turn off VPN or proxy and retry registration from your regular UK IP.
- If you’re on mobile, switch between Wi-Fi and mobile data.
Password and username rules
Follow password complexity guidelines: minimum length, mix of characters, no common dictionary words. Try a different username if the one you want is taken or flagged.
KYC and ID verification
Sometimes registration completes but verification stalls because documents are unclear. To speed this up:
- Upload clear scans or photos of passport/driving license and proof of address (utility bill/bank statement).
- Make sure documents are current and fully visible with all corners included.
Payment method issues during sign-up
If the initial deposit or bonus activation fails:
- Check that your card or e-wallet supports gambling transactions and is registered to you.
- Try an alternative payment method if possible.
- Confirm with your bank that the transaction wasn’t blocked for security reasons.
When to contact Slot Lair support
If the above steps don’t work after several attempts, contact Slot Lair’s customer support. Prepare the following before reaching out:
- Screenshot of error messages and the page where the problem occurred.
- Time and date of failed attempts.
- Details of the browser/device used and your IP (if known).
- Copies of requested identification if verification is the issue.
How to contact support
Use the live chat on the Slot Lair site for quickest response. If live chat is unavailable, send a support email with your details and attachments. Keep messages clear and concise to speed resolution.

Legal and security checks
Slot Lair must comply with UK gambling regulations. If your registration is blocked due to legal or regulatory flags, the support team will usually explain the reason and the steps to correct it. Be ready to follow age verification and anti-money laundering (AML) checks.
What if I’m permanently blocked?
Permanent blocks are rare and usually tied to prior self-exclusion, previous fraud, erroneous account records, or regulatory restrictions. If you believe the block is a mistake, escalate via support and provide ID evidence. If unresolved, request a formal review or complaint and follow Slot Lair’s appeals procedure.
